About Practice

Accenture’s M&A and Private Equity Consulting practice partners with Private Equity (PE) firms and Corporate clients across the deal lifecycle — from diligence and deal execution to integration, separation, and transformation.

Our France-focused M&A team supports both French corporations and global investors entering or expanding in France. With bilingual (French and English) capabilities, the team enables seamless client engagement, cultural alignment, and delivery of high-value consulting engagements.
